
Charlie Kirk’s Big Connection To The State of Montana
On Wednesday afternoon, the country came to a standstill as political activist and social media personality, Charlie Kirk was shot and killed at his event in Utah. Multiple people in attendance captured the tragedy on their phones, giving the rest of the country a terrifying look at the violence that took place.
Charlie Kirk's Connection to Montana
Kirk was no stranger to Montana and featured the state heavily during one of his visits back on Thursday, October 10, 2024.
Kirk was visiting Montana in support of Senator Tim Sheehy's campaign.
"While visiting Montana to pump up Tim Sheehy's crucial Senate campaign, Charlie paid a visit to the University of Montana to take questions from students," the podcast's episode says.

Senator Tim Sheehy Reacts To Charlie Kirk's Murder
Senator Tim Sheehy, like all of us, was taken back by the news and offered his condolences on the platform X, formerly known as Twitter.
"This is heartbreaking news," the post read, "Charlie was a good man and a patriot who fought tirelessly to make our country better. The impact of his work on behalf of the conservative movement and to encourage young people to engage in our politics will be felt for generations to come."

"Please join our family in praying for his wife, his children, and all those he inspired across the nation and around the world."
